摘要: 针对具有动态故障模式的复杂系统,动态故障树分析一直是很重要的可靠性分析技术。为了提升可靠性分析效率,已有研究提出了各种模块化方法,但是对于实际动态故障树模型中由于事件关联导致的大型动态子树,这些模块化方法的状态空间爆炸问题仍然很突出。因此介绍了一种基于多值决策图(Multiple-valued Decision Diagrams,MDD)来分析动态故障树的方法,通过多值变量编码动态门,利用单一系统MDD模型刻画各种动态和静态可靠性行为,有效地缓解了状态爆炸问题。通过一个具体的实例说明了多值决策图方法的应用和优势。
